### PR: Pin Lattice component library to explicit version ranges

This change moves the shared Lattice components off floating minor versions. Consumers were picking up breaking patch releases, so we now pin and bump via the release bot. Nothing changes for apps already on 4.x. For the sync: the resolver knobs we standardized on are below.

tuning constants:
QUOTAS = {
    "druwyn": 5,
    "holix": 5,
    "zorath": 5,
    "holwyn": 10,
}

CI note — Drossel component library. Builds fail when the lockfile pins 3.4 but the pipeline cache serves 3.5 artifacts. Fix: purge the shared cache stage before resolve, or bump the cache key with the library version. Do not retry blindly; it masks the skew. Confirm the resolved version matches the build token that follows.

session token of yajof-bagef = htk4_937d

Subject: Release 4.8 — encoding detection fix for uploads

Team,

Shipping today: Fernwheel's upload pipeline now sniffs encoding on text files before parsing. Fixes the garbled-characters tickets from last week — Latin-1 and Shift-JIS files were being force-read as UTF-8. Detection falls back to UTF-8 with replacement chars only if confidence is below 60%, and flags the file for review. No action needed from support beyond closing related tickets. Rollback plan is in the release doc. Build token for this release follows.

trace token, kahog-tajeg: htk6_97d963

**Ticket: Config drift — Larkwell Wiki RBAC**

Priority: High. During the quarterly review we found the production Larkwell wiki's role-based access settings no longer match the approved baseline. Someone widened the editor role to include space-admin rights and disabled group sync sometime in the last month; no change record exists. Staging still matches baseline. Requesting security review before we revert, in case the drift was exploited. For comparison, the current production values as read from the live instance are below.

deployment values, yadug-bawif:
[framir]
team = pelox
access_code = ac_a38ab2
owner = tamion.julael
host = framir.tolvaqlabs.test
port = 11211
peer = tammir.zemvargrid.local
salt = 2215ef03
pin = 1541